Optimize capture of recyclable fiber
The Sustainble Waste Systems Cortex ™ high-speed, intelligent robotics system removes contamination on fiber lines to recover higher-grade OCC (corrugated cardboard), mixed paper, SOP (sorted office paper), newsprint, and more. Generate cleaner bales for higher end-market pricing with continuous improvements in sorting efficacy and reliability driven by the industry’s most expansive AI platform.
Shape the sorting process with AI
Our AI is unique in its ability to learn new packaging to the specificity of a manufacturer or brand. Working with Sonoco, we created a new material category within our neural network specific to rigid paperboard cans, helping increase recycling rates for this material type across manufacturers. Producers are influencing what’s recoverable in recycling facilities and taking advantage of the ability to capture more of their specific packaging as they work toward ambitious sustainability goals.
